Friday Preview: 7-AAA Title Game at Allatoona

Allatoona plays at home while North Cobb travels.

Ridgeland (6-3, 5-0) at Allatoona (9-0, 5-0) - Region 7-AAA is split into two subregions of six teams. But only four of the 12 teams will qualify for the playoffs. That’s why, this week, the top teams from each subregion will compete in play-in games. The 7-AAA title game will be held tonight at when the Buccaneers host Ridgeland. Neither team has lost in region play, but Ridgeland has three blemishes outside the Region 7-AAA confines. Allatoona is perfect this year and is ranked fifth in the state.

North Cobb (4-5, 3-3) at Harrison (3-6, 2-4) – There are a number of ways that can qualify for the postseason, but the easiest way is to win tonight at Harrison. If the Warriors win, they’re in. Even with a loss, if South Cobb also loses, North Cobb will participate in the playoffs. Harrison lost for the first time in three weeks last Friday, and can’t qualify for the playoffs. But, the Hoyas can sure play spoiler.
